What to Eat

Manoppello is known for its traditional Abruzzo c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Arrosticini: Grilled lamb or mutton skewers
  • Pallotte cacio e ova: Cheese and egg dumplings
  • Pasta alla chitarra: A type of pasta made with a chitarra, a special tool that cuts the pasta into thin, square strands

Where to Go

There are several things to see and do in Manoppello, including:

  • The Basilica of the Holy Face: This basilica is home to a relic of the Holy Face of Jesus.
  • The Castello di Manoppello: This castle was built in the 11th century and offers stunning views of the surrounding countryside.
  • The Museo delle Arti e Tradizioni Popolari: This museum showcases the traditional arts and crafts of Manoppello.
